  • T8 Black light scoring isues with Vector Plus

    We recently converted our Zot dual ballast fixtures to T8 bulbs and ballast. Since then we have had allot of scoring issues. any suggestions on how to fix this would be greatly appreciated. Thanks again,Sid

  • #2
    Bulbs most likely too bright causing glare, especially with glo pins. Try covering a section of bulb on line between camera and headpin with paper towel tube or tape, or try a dimmer bulb.

    • #3
      With the Vector system, you have the ability to adjust the settings for what is standing pins and what isn't.
      If you go into the camera settings, with the lights in the center off and the black pin deck lights on, click on the "Test night" button. Check the readings and change the number in the "Night" box to about 20% less than your lowest reading.

        • #5
          If it is the same video 3 board used on V+ there is an adjustment pot on the board that you can adjust to make it less intense. Do the pins look like they are bleeding over one another?

            Only problem with adjusting the Video3 board is that it is also going to effect the scoring under normal lighting. Then he would have to go in and adjust the "Day" settings under the camera settings.
